I. Understanding the Appeal of Russian Loans: 1. Favorable Interest Rates: One of the primary factors attracting investors to Russian loans is the comparatively higher interest rates offered by Russian financial institutions. With the global economy experiencing low-interest rates, Spanish investors are finding the prospect of better returns in Russian loans highly enticing. 2. Diversification Strategy: Investing in Russian loans allows Spanish investors to diversify their portfolios and reduce their exposure to domestic market risks. By venturing into the Russian market, investors are not only expanding their investment horizon but also potentially hedging against any adverse fluctuations in the Spanish economy. 3. Long-Term Growth Potential: Russia's robust economic outlook and ongoing infrastructure development projects present attractive opportunities for long-term growth. Spanish investors who have been eyeing emerging markets find Russian loans to be a viable investment option that aligns with their appetite for higher returns in the future. II. Analyzing the Risks Involved: 1. Political and Regulatory Challenges: When investing in any foreign market, investors should be aware of the political climate and regulatory landscape. While Russia holds promise, it also poses certain challenges due to geopolitical tensions and varying degrees of transparency. Scrutinizing local policies and understanding the legal framework is crucial to mitigating potential risks. 2. Currency Fluctuations: Investing in Russian loans raises the issue of currency risk. Fluctuations in the exchange rate between the Russian ruble and the euro can impact the returns for Spanish investors. Careful consideration of foreign exchange dynamics is vital to managing currency-related uncertainties. III. Evaluating Risk-Mitigation Strategies: 1. Thorough Due Diligence: Conducting meticulous research and analysis on the potential issuer of Russian loans is essential. Examining the borrower's financial stability, creditworthiness, and payment track record can provide valuable insights to mitigate investment risks. 2. Partnering with Expert Advisors: Collaborating with professional advisors who possess in-depth knowledge and experience in the Russian loan market can significantly enhance an investor's chances of success. These advisors can offer guidance on legal and regulatory compliance, as well as help navigate the intricacies of investing in a foreign market.
